 Peter Wafula is not just a teacher. He is a leader born in the classroom and refined through service. From Dagoretti High School, where he serves as a dedicated teacher and Boarding Master, to representing Nairobi teachers in national and continental platforms, Mr. Wafula has shown what it means to rise by lifting others. He is the Welfare Chairman at Dagoretti High, the Founder and Chairman of Nairobi County Teachers Forum CBO, and the Lead Organizer of the 2024 World Teachers’ Day Celebrations in Nairobi. Teachers don’t just know him—they trust him. --- His Journey in Service: Teacher & Boarding Master, Dagoretti High School – championing a healthy school environment and teacher welfare. Welfare Chairman, Dagoretti – listening to teachers’ needs and fighting for their dignity. Founder & Chair, Nairobi County Teachers Forum – uniting educators for strength, voice, and vision. Lead Organizer, 2024 World Teachers Day in Nairobi – showing the power of a teacher-led movement. Peace Club Coordinator, Nairobi – building harmony in schools. Chairman, Junior Achievement Patrons Association – raising future leaders through mentorship. Protocol Officer, ACFTA Council of Ministers Conference – representing teachers on continental stages. Technical Official, World School Cross Country Championship – serving beyond borders. Certified Trainer of Trainers, Junior Achievement Kenya – empowering peers in financial literacy. Lead Mentor, Junior Achievement Competition in Accra, Ghana – global experience with local grounding. Former Secretary General, Kenyatta University Western Students Association – leadership from youth.
